How AI has changed the MEAN Stack job market

A well-planned MEAN Stack Developer roadmap starts with understanding how the job market has changed in the last five years.

Five years ago, companies hired junior Mean Stack Developers for siloed tasks such as writing boilerplate code, fixing minor bugs, or creating simple HTML/CSS pages. Today, AI coding assistants such as GitHub Copilot, ChatGPT, and Claude automate much of that routine work, allowing developers to focus more on solving problems and building features. Employers increasingly expect freshers to contribute to end-to-end feature development much earlier, using modern development tools and AI coding assistants.

MEAN Stack career path mapping

Career path mapping is an essential part of a MEAN Stack Developer roadmap because it helps freshers set realistic career goals.

1. Entry-Level (0–2 Years)

  • Job Roles: Associate MEAN Stack Developer, Junior Full-Stack Engineer, Trainee Angular Developer, Junior Backend Developer (Node.js).
  • Service-Based MNC Range: ₹3.5 LPA – ₹4.5 LPA
  • Product Startup / Premium Range: ₹5.0 LPA – ₹7.5+ LPA
  • Market Average: ₹3.8 LPA – ₹5.5 LPA

2. Mid-Level (3–6 Years)

  • Job Roles: Full-Stack MEAN Engineer, Full-Stack Developer, Frontend Specialist (Angular), Node.js API Engineer.
  • Service-Based MNC Range: ₹6.0 LPA – ₹8.5 LPA
  • Product Startup / Premium Range: ₹9.0 LPA – ₹14.0+ LPA
  • Market Average: ₹7.0 LPA – ₹9.5 LPA

3. Senior Level (6–10 Years)

  • Job Roles: Senior Full-Stack Engineer, Lead MEAN Developer, Lead Full-Stack Engineer, Senior Software Engineer (Full Stack).
  • Service-Based MNC Range: ₹11.0 LPA – ₹16.0 LPA
  • Product Startup / Premium Range: ₹18.0 LPA – ₹30.0+ LPA
  • Market Average: ₹14.5 LPA – ₹22.0 LPA

4. Expert Level (10+ Years)

  • Job Roles: Principal Full-Stack Architect, Cloud and Web Platform Architect, Head of Web Engineering, Director of Engineering.
  • Service-Based MNC Range: ₹24.0 LPA – ₹35.0 LPA
  • Product Startup / Premium Range: ₹40.0 LPA – ₹65.0+ LPA
  • Market Average: ₹35.0 LPA – ₹48.0 LPA

Note: The above salary data are approximate annual CTC projections based on the latest Indian job market trends. Your actual salary may vary depending on various factors, such as job location, company type, technical expertise, interview performance, and your experience band. Also, product companies and big startups may also offer bonuses or stock-based compensation in addition to base salary.

What educational background do freshers need for MEAN Stack Developer jobs?

How to become a MEAN Stack Developer begins with understanding the employer’s expectations regarding baseline educational requirements.

Common educational backgrounds: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science (B.Tech / B.E. in CSE/IT), Computer Applications (BCA), or Information Technology (B.Sc IT).
  • Non-CS engineering streams (such as ECE, EEE, or Mechanical) or general science graduates (B.Sc in Physics/Maths).
  • An MCA or M.Tech provides an added advantage for specialized enterprise roles.

But a specific degree is no longer strictly required to get hired as a MEAN Stack Developer. A strong portfolio, solid JavaScript fundamentals, and hands-on projects can significantly improve your chances of securing a MEAN Stack Developer job as a fresher.

Best online MEAN Stack certifications for freshers

How to become a MEAN Stack Developer also involves earning recognized certifications that strengthen your technical profile.

MongoDB Associate Developer Exam

Cost: Paid

The MongoDB Associate Developer certification can be a valuable addition to your MEAN Stack Developer roadmap.

The certification is offered by MongoDB. Candidates can prepare through MongoDB’s official learning platform and practice using MongoDB Atlas.

This certification evaluates MongoDB fundamentals, including data modeling, CRUD operations, aggregation, indexing, MongoDB Atlas concepts, and application development using MongoDB drivers. It validates your understanding of MongoDB and NoSQL database fundamentals to prospective employers. You can prepare for this exam through MongoDB University and practice on MongoDB Atlas for free.

Junior Angular Developer Certification

Cost: Paid

The Junior Angular Developer Certification is offered by Certificates.dev and developed with contributions from Google Developer Experts (GDEs).

This entry-level certification assesses knowledge of Angular concepts, including components, TypeScript, RxJS, Reactive Forms, and single-page application development. This certification can strengthen your resume when applying for entry-level MEAN Stack Developer roles.

AWS Certified Cloud Practitioner

Cost: Paid

Administered by Amazon Web Services (AWS), this certification demonstrates foundational AWS cloud knowledge and can strengthen your profile when applying for MEAN Stack Developer jobs.

It covers IAM, core AWS services such as EC2 and S3, security, pricing, and architectural concepts. It demonstrates a foundational understanding of AWS cloud services, security, pricing, and core deployment concepts, which can strengthen a fresher’s profile. You can learn this exam via AWS Skill Builder – Cloud Practitioner Essentials.

Fresher-friendly MEAN Stack projects for portfolio

How to become a MEAN Stack Developer involves gaining practical knowledge by building real-world projects. Projects help recruiters evaluate your ability to apply MEAN Stack concepts, build functional applications, and follow real-world development practices.

To stand out in the interview process, consider building the following MEAN Stack projects for your portfolio.

  • E-Commerce Platform with Payment Gateway: Online store featuring product search, cart management, user authentication, and optional payment gateway integration.
  • Role-based Task and Team Dashboard: A workspace app with secure login, role-based access control, task assignments, and file uploads.
  • Real-Time Collaboration App: A real-time collaboration app using WebSockets/Socket.IO for live messaging, group chat rooms, and notifications.
  • AI-Powered Blogging or Note App: Content platform integrating AI APIs for features such as summarization, categorization, or content assistance.

Once you complete your projects, upload the code to a GitHub repository and deploy your Angular frontend using platforms such as Vercel or Netlify, host your Node.js/Express backend using platforms such as Render, and use MongoDB Atlas for database hosting.

Career opportunities for MEAN Stack Developers

Targeting the right job roles and internship opportunities is an important phase of a MEAN Stack Developer roadmap.

Once you have built MEAN Stack projects for your portfolio, you should review suitable job titles for freshers and the expected MEAN Stack Developer salary for those roles.

Job title targetFocus areaSalary range in India
Associate MEAN Stack DeveloperComplete end-to-end web applications₹3.5 LPA – ₹6.5 LPA
Trainee / Junior Angular DeveloperFrontend components, RxJS, and UI logic₹3.0 LPA – ₹5.0 LPA
Junior Backend Developer (Node.js)REST APIs, database queries, and routing₹3.2 LPA – ₹5.5 LPA
Full-Stack Software Engineering InternBug fixes, small feature updates, testing₹1.2 LPA – ₹4.0 LPA

Internships can significantly improve your chances of getting full-time MEAN Stack Developer jobs by providing practical experience and industry exposure. You should use Internshala, LinkedIn, Wellfound (formerly AngelList Talent), and Unstop (formerly Dare2Compete) for MEAN Stack internships.

Networking and referrals tips for MEAN Stack freshers

Networking and referrals should be included in every MEAN Stack Developer roadmap to improve interview opportunities. Start by building a complete LinkedIn profile that showcases your live MEAN Stack projects and includes a GitHub link. Send personalized connection requests to developers, tech leads, recruiters, and engineering managers while engaging meaningfully with their posts or company updates.

Share 30-second video walkthroughs or code snippets of your projects publicly on LinkedIn to build credibility. Join active developer communities on GitHub, LinkedIn, Discord, Reddit, and X (Twitter) to learn from experienced developers, contribute to discussions, and discover job opportunities.

Tips for MEAN Stack resume and interview preparation

How to become a MEAN Stack Developer also depends on preparing an ATS-friendly resume and preparing for interviews.

To build an ATS-friendly resume, consider the following tips.

  • Keep your resume to one page.
  • Use a simple single-column design to improve readability for recruiters and compatibility with most ATS systems.
  • Focus on listing skills and projects clearly.
  • Place GitHub repositories and deployed application links (such as Vercel, Netlify, Render, or other hosting platforms) near the top.

For interviews, strong proficiency in core JavaScript fundamentals is essential. Practice coding problems on platforms such as HackerRank, LeetCode, or CodeSignal, and prepare to answer interview questions on JavaScript, Angular, Node.js, REST APIs, and databases. Be prepared to walk through your project architecture step by step.
